Hey im about to get my 12 gallon dx nano cube and i want to see some pictures of yours guys nano cube's to get an idea for my aquascaping.Any suggestion on what kind of fish to put in?
 
A 12g is too small for a Blenny imo. I would go with a Black and White Ocellaris Clownfish, or a Firefish along with a small Goby such as a Trimma, Masked, Neon, Clown, etc.

Good luck with your tank and be sure to post pics.
 
I think you can keep A blenny in your 12 gallon. I have one in my 12 gallon. He is the only rock hopping fish. As long as he is the only rock hopping fish that is fine. He shares his home with a black ocellaris clown.
